Chemonade by True Canna Genetics

Chemonade, developed by True Canna Genetics, is a hybrid strain resulting from meticulous selective breeding. It aims to blend traditional cannabis cultivation with modern genetic understanding, offering a reliably distinct and balanced experience.

Appearance

Chemonade buds are visually striking, characterized by dense formations with a mix of deep green and purple hues. The surface is heavily coated in light-reflective trichomes, giving them a frosty appearance that signifies potency.

Aroma & Flavor

The aroma of Chemonade is a complex blend, initially presenting bright citrus notes that are balanced by subtle earthy undertones. Upon consumption, the flavor mirrors this profile, offering a layered experience of sweet citrus complemented by herbal nuances, often with a refreshing minty or lemony finish.

Effects

This hybrid strain is noted for providing a balanced effect, combining a cerebral uplift with a sense of physical relaxation. Users often report feeling calm and experiencing a boost in creativity, making it suitable for various times of day.

Terpenes & Cannabinoids

Chemonade typically exhibits THC levels between 18% and 22%, with minimal CBD content (<1%). Its terpene profile is rich in compounds like Myrcene, Limonene, Caryophyllene, Linalool, and Pinene, contributing to its distinct aroma and flavor. Minor cannabinoids are also present, supporting the overall entourage effect.

Origins & Lineage

Developed by True Canna Genetics, Chemonade is the product of extensive selective breeding aimed at creating a stable and unique hybrid. Its genetic makeup is reported to be nearly evenly split between indica and sativa influences, drawing from decades of cultivation history.

Growing

Cultivation trials indicate that Chemonade exhibits high phenotypic consistency, with over 98% expression reliability. The strain is known for its symmetrical colas and generous resin production, suggesting a robust plant structure suitable for various growing conditions.
